How to Move PS5 Games to External HDD to Make More Console Space

In case you missed the big news today, Sony released a new firmware update for the PS5 that added the ability to store PS5 games on an external hard drive. If you are wondering how this is done, we here at MP1st have prepared a short guide, detailing how to move PS5 games to an external HDD.

How to Move PS5 Games to External HDD

Honestly it’s not a very complicated process. To get started, all you need to have is an external HDD that supports USB connectivity. We recommend an external HDD that supports USB 3.0 as the speeds are far faster in terms of transfer rate. A external SSD is also one we recommend, but if it’s cost purposes definitely a USB 3.0 supported drive. If you are using one already for PS4 games this same one will also work. You PS5 also has to be up-to-date on the latest software. More information about updating PS5 software can be found at the official PS5 Software update page.

Step 1: Plug in your external HDD and allow the system to format the drive. If you are already using this drive on the PS5 for PS4 games then you will not need to format.

Step 2: Now that your drive is properly formatted, you can now begin copying PS5 games over to it. To do this, navigate to the system settings and then go to storage, select console storage, and finally select games and app.

Step 3: From this next menu, you will want to hit R1 to move to the “Move PS5 Games” tab. You will get a small warning that the games are only playable on the internal SSD. Acknowledge it and now you can freely pick whatever PS5 game you want to move over. Easy peasy!

Why Move My PS5 Games to an External HDD?

One of the biggest reasons you will want to move some of your PS5 games to an external HDD is because it can save you a ton of time from having to redownload said games. Due to the limited amount of space on the PS5 built-in SSD, users have had the tough choice of deleting old games to make for new ones. Issue with this is, if you want to play an old game you have to redownload it and depending on your internet speeds that can be an all day (or more) thing.

Copying from an external HDD to internal is significantly faster than redownloading.

Can I Play PS5 Games Off an External Hard Drive?

At the time of writing, there is no support to play PS5 games off an external hard drive, nor is it likely to happen. Unlike the Xbox Series consoles, the PS5 only supports internal SSD. There is an expansion slot, but Sony has yet to allow additional storage space to be added.

How Do I Move PS5 Games Back to PS5?

It’s the same process as above, only instead of selecting console storage you pick the USB extended storage option. A “PS5 Move Game” option is located in the storage option.

Based on the 1996 game that was first released by SEGA in arcades, The House of the Dead is a two-player game that sees players fight hordes of zombies and monsters using guns, with the story unfolding through chapters as you beat down enemies through a linear path and progress through after defeating them. It’s basically Time Crisis meets Resident Evil, and like the latter game this helped popularize the zombie and horror themed video game genres of that gaming generation.

  • Store PS5 Games on Compatible External USB Drives.* With this feature, you can now transfer your PS5 games to USB extended storage from your console’s internal storage. It’s a great way to extend the storage capabilities of your PS5 console, and you can seamlessly copy your PS5 games back to the console’s internal storage when you’re ready to play. It is faster to reinstall PS5 games from USB extended storage than to re-download or copy them from a disc.
    • Because PS5 games are designed to take advantage of the console’s ultra high-speed SSD, PS5 titles can’t be played from USB extended storage. PS5 titles also cannot be directly downloaded to USB extended storage. However, games that you transfer or copy back to internal storage will automatically update when applicable. In addition, you can select which game modes you want to install (such as campaign or multiplayer) for select titles that support the option.
    • For tips on using USB extended storage on PS5, including storage device requirements, please visit: https://www.playstation.com/en-us/support/hardware/ps5-extended-storage/.

Over 475,000 Call of Duty Warzone Cheaters Banned This Week, Activision Going After Cheat Makers

It’s never fun to play a multiplayer game when someone is cheating. Unfortunately, there’s a ton of that in Call of Duty: Warzone. Activisio is aware of this, and has issued an update on what steps the company is doing. One big step announced is how over 475,000 Call of Duty Warzone cheaters have been perma-banned this week!

Cheaters are never welcome. To date, our security and enforcement team has issued more than 475,000 permabans in Call of Duty: Warzone. Yesterday’s large banwave was our seventh high-volume set of bans since February.

Additionally, the company has also mentioned how they are going after cheat makers, and those who sell accounts.

We also are tackling the commercial market of cheat providers and resellers. This includes suspicious accounts, which are farmed and often sold to repeat offenders. We recently banned 45,000 fraudulent, black market accounts used by repeat offenders.

Removing cheaters and taking away their ability to move to alternate accounts is a key focus for the security teams.

Activision has also announced that they have ramped up the fight in a few key areas:

  • Utilizing 2-factor authentication to make it harder to access new accounts simply to cheat
  • Ramping-up additional resources to support our security and enforcement teams
  • Increased frequency of high-volume banwaves in addition to our daily banning of repeat offending accounts
  • Improving regular communications and updates

Finally, on the subject of hardware bans, here’s what Activision had to say:

Some have asked if we issue hardware bans. We do issue hardware bans against repeat, or serial, cheaters. This is an important part of our effort to combat repeat offenders.
